I had a conversation with Doc Barranti a short while ago and asked him to build me one of his pocket holsters for my pre-war 2" 1905.
I had been using the Heiser IWB holster I found a while ago as a pocket holster. It worked well, but lacked pizzazz, so I asked Doc to "pimp" this one out a little for me.
Here is what he came up with. I am impressed to say the least. It is very secure, the revolver slides out easily on demand, but rides snugly otherwise. The holster never shifts, does not try to come out with the gun and does not "print". I use it in my front pocket, but it fits easily as well in the back.
Not just tooled, but lined to boot. It just seems such a shame to hide it in my pocket.
